Hi there.

I was hoping someone might be able to tell me the proper way to adjust the SCV on my 2120.

The story is that the lever suddenly felt like it wasn't engaging anything, so I pulled the top cap off, and seeing the 4 adjustment bolts, took them off thinking I might be able to get further into the unit to see what was wrong. I now realize my mistake and wish I did some research first.

Turns out the problem is a broken roll pin.

When I removed the adjustment bolts, two of them broke, and they must have been mostly broken before I touched them as it barely took any force. So I will need to replace at least two of them.

The other thing is, in mine, they are a short threaded rod with a nut on. There is no slot or Allen key for adjustment, so I'm wondering if there is a different way to set it up? All I have found discusses doing 1/8 or 1/4 turns, which seems hard to do accurately, with no slots in the bolts etc.

Lastly, with no slots in the bolts, can I just make my own replacements out of a 1/4 bolt and not, cut to the right size?

Thanks in advance for the help.
